    INTRODUCTION:

    Rogues at level 10 have a very high burst, and their large dodge gives them good survivability in combat. However, on the downside, while they do tons of damage, they lack key elements such as crowd control and mobility. Learning to use your cooldowns at the right time can greatly increase your odds in winning a fight.

    RACES:

    ALLY:

    Human: Every man for himself is a great cooldown that substitutes for your insignia.

    Gnome: Only viable as an engineer due to their instant-bombs.

    Worgen: The Worgen's sprint racial makes them a more mobile race, they also have extra crit.

    Night Elf: Nelfs are always nice for the bonus base agility, not to mention their neat racial Shadowmeld.

    HORDE:

    Troll: The berserker buff usually is great in combination with Lifeblood, boosting your attack speed by 20%. Trolls also get some extra agility.

    Orc: Orcs have their attack power racial which is pretty decent in combination with Lifeblood. They also have some more stamina than other races.

    Blood Elf: Because of the blood elf's AoE silence, it is one of the most viable level 10 twink rogue races.

    Goblin: Goblins have their great racial, Rocket Jump, which gives them awesome mobility. They also have their +3 agility almost-bis-bracers from their ending quest.

    All in all, you're best going with a blood elf, troll, or night elf.

    PROFESSIONS:

    Herbalism: 225 herbalism gives a 55 haste Lifeblood at level 10.

    Skinning: 225 skinning will give you 9 crit, about 17% crit at level 10 which is amazing.

    Mining: 225 mining will give you 70 extra health.

    Engineering: 150 engineering will grant you access to some CCs; like bombs.

    Couple wrong things I read.
    Worgen has the 1% crit, not night elves. Night elves have the highest base agility though.
    Gnomes should also be added if you choose engineering for instant bombs.
    Tauren can't play rogues.
    Troll racial boosts attack speed, not haste, so it does not affect your energy regeneration like haste.
     
    Last edited by a moderator:
    Dwarves, undead, and pandaren can also be rogues. Dwarves get the poison/bleed removal+reduce damage taken CD. Undead get a mini-LS racial and a fear/ charm/sleep trinket which shares a 30sec CD with PvP trinket. Pandaren get a 3 sec incapacitation cc, giving Rogues at least 1 for level 10s.
    Gnomes have escape artist, removes snares and roots.

    I am also assuming you are focusing on subtlety more, so a couple added notes:
    Assassination rogues should use a dagger on main hand, too.
    Combat rogues should use a slow offhand weapon.

    Additional notes:
    16 armor kit can be used on boa pants, and 24 armor kit can be used on UNBOUND embossed leather pants.
